Cats may drink out of your cup because they are curious, seeking attention, or simply prefer the taste or temperature of the liquid inside. It is also possible that they are attracted to the scent of the drink.

Why do cats drink loudly?

When cats drink, they stick their ngue in the water, cup the tongue, pull it back into thier mouth and then swallow it. What you are hearing is the impact of the tongue against the water.

Is it safe for cats to drink seawater?

No, it is not safe for cats to drink seawater. Seawater is too salty for cats and can lead to dehydration and other health issues. Cats should only drink fresh water.

How do cats typically drink water, including the behavior of using their paw to scoop and drink water?

Cats typically drink water by lapping it up with their tongues. Some cats may use their paws to scoop water and then bring it to their mouths to drink. This behavior is more common in wild cats and can be seen in domestic cats as well.
